SPRINGFIELD, Ohio — SPRINGFIELD, Ohio - The annual presentation of the Gabrieli Brass Festival will be held at 3 p.m. Sunday, April 4, in Weaver Chapel on the Wittenberg University campus.
This celebration of the music of Giovanni Gabrieli and other composers for brass instruments is hosted by the Wittenberg Brass Choir, under the direction of Daniel Zehringer, adjunct instructor of music.
Guest ensembles will include the Wright State University Trumpet Ensemble and Bowling Green State University Tuba/Euphonium Ensemble. The Virtuoso Brass, a professional brass quintet consisting of musicians from the Cincinnati and Dayton area, will also perform.
Always a favorite part of the concert, the finale will feature music by the mass ensemble. The acoustics of Weaver Chapel are ideal for the antiphonal brass music composed by Gabrieli.
The Gabrieli Brass Festival is free and open to the public. For more information contact the music department at (937) 327-7341.
